The primary danger of using nulled themes is the inclusion of malicious code. Hackers often inject "backdoors" into these files, allowing them to gain administrative access to your site. This can lead to your site being used to spread malware, send spam emails, or steal sensitive user information. Because these themes do not receive official security patches, your site remains permanently vulnerable to newly discovered exploits.
Furthermore, nulled themes lack the essential support and update infrastructure provided by legitimate developers. WordPress is constantly evolving; without regular updates, a pirated theme will eventually break, causing layout issues or total site failure. You also lose access to professional technical support, leaving you to troubleshoot complex bugs alone. This downtime and the potential cost of hiring a developer to fix a hacked site far exceed the price of a legal license.
From an SEO and performance perspective, pirated themes are often bloated with hidden "black hat" links that redirect your traffic to suspicious websites. Search engines like Google penalize sites associated with malware or spam, which can result in your website being deindexed entirely. Additionally, poorly optimized code in nulled versions can significantly slow down your page load speeds, frustrating users and further damaging your search rankings.

What is the MH Magazine WordPress Theme?
MH Magazine is one of the most popular WordPress themes for editorial websites, online magazines, and news portals. It is highly valued for its:
Widgetized Homepage: Allowing you to drag and drop sections to create a custom layout.
SEO Optimization: Built with clean code to help your news stories rank faster.
Responsive Design: Ensuring your content looks great on smartphones and tablets.
Custom Widgets: Including sliders, post grids, and social media integrations specifically designed for publishers. The Risks of Using Nulled Themes
"Nulled" refers to premium software that has been hacked to bypass licensing requirements. While the "207" version might promise the latest features for free, the hidden costs are often much higher:
Malware and Backdoors: Nulled themes are notorious for containing hidden scripts. These can be used to steal user data, inject spammy SEO links into your site, or give hackers remote access to your server.
Lack of Updates: WordPress frequently updates its core software. A nulled theme cannot be updated through official channels, meaning your site will eventually break or become vulnerable to new security exploits.
No Support: When a layout issue arises or a plugin conflicts with your theme, you won't have access to the MH Themes support team to fix it.
Legal and Ethical Issues: Using nulled software violates the developers' Terms of Service and can lead to your hosting provider suspending your account. Why the Official Version is "Better"

"Nulled" themes are premium WordPress themes that have been modified to remove license checks. They are distributed for free on third-party websites. While free software sounds appealing, it comes with massive hidden costs. 1. Malicious Code and Malware
Hackers do not distribute premium themes for free out of kindness. They pack these files with malicious scripts, including:
Backdoors: Allowing hackers full access to your website and server.
Malicious Redirects: Sending your hard-earned traffic to spam or phishing sites.
Hidden Ads: Injecting spam links into your content to steal your SEO authority. 2. Devastating SEO Consequences
Search engines like Google actively scan for hacked websites. If your nulled theme contains spammy outbound links or redirects, Google will penalize your site. You could lose all your search rankings or get completely blacklisted. 3. Zero Updates and Support
WordPress frequently updates its core software to fix security loopholes. Premium themes release updates to remain compatible. Nulled themes do not receive automatic updates. Over time, your site will break or become highly vulnerable to attacks. 4. Data Theft and Privacy Breaches
If you run an e-commerce store or collect user emails, a nulled theme puts your users at risk. Hackers can easily steal customer data, credit card information, and login credentials, leaving you legally liable. 📰 Why MH Magazine is Worth Buying Legally Summarize its legitimate features and benefits

1. Theme Capabilities: Why MH Magazine is Popular
If you were to download the legitimate version of MH Magazine v2.0.7, you would find a highly functional, no-nonsense theme designed specifically for online magazines.
- Layout Flexibility: The standout feature remains the Magazine Homepage Template. It allows users to create a dynamic front page using widget areas. You can arrange posts by category, popularity, or tag without needing a complex page builder like Elementor. It is lightweight and fast compared to bloat-heavy competitors.
- v2.0.7 Updates: This specific version brought compatibility updates for the latest WordPress releases (Gutenberg/block editor support) and minor bug fixes in responsive styling. It ensures the theme works seamlessly on mobile devices—a critical factor for modern SEO.
- Customization: The WordPress Customizer integration is deep. You can change color schemes, typography, and layouts in real-time. It supports Google Fonts natively, allowing for significant branding changes without coding.
- Performance: MH Magazine is known for clean code. It is lightweight, loading significantly faster than multipurpose themes like Avada or Divi. This is a massive plus for Core Web Vitals and ad revenue (AdSense compatibility is built-in).
2. The "Nulled" Reality: The Hidden Costs of "Free"
The search term "nulled" implies a version where the license verification has been stripped out to make it free. While this saves you roughly $49 on a license, the "better" aspect of your search query is highly debatable for the following reasons:
- Malware Injection: The most common issue with nulled themes (especially version-specific archives like 2.0.7 found on random forums) is malicious code injection. Hackers often embed crypto-miners, SEO spam links (hidden text linking to gambling or pharma sites), or backdoors into the
footer.phporfunctions.phpfiles. These can get your site blacklisted by Google within weeks. - No Updates: Version 2.0.7 is a specific snapshot in time. WordPress core updates frequently. Using a nulled theme means you cannot update the theme without losing the "crack." Eventually, a WordPress core update will break the theme, or a security vulnerability will be discovered in the theme’s code that remains unpatched on your site.
- Lack of Support: MH Themes offers solid support. If you encounter a conflict with a plugin, you are on your own with a nulled version. Forums generally will not help users with pirated software.
